大纲:1. 引言2. 什么是区块链备案3. 区块链备案的重要性4. 区块链备案的流程5. 区块链最新备案编号的获取途径6. 相...
区块链技术近年来在金融、供应链、物联网等多个领域取得了广泛应用,然而很多人对区块链的基础层级及其结构并不太了解。为了更好地理解区块链技术,我们需要从它的基础层级入手,探讨区块链的组成部分、工作原理及其潜在的应用场景。
区块链是一种分布式数据库技术,它通过去中心化的方式实现对数据的记录和管理。最早被广泛认可的是比特币的背后技术,而这项技术的核心特点是去中心化、透明性和不可篡改性。区块链不仅可以用于加密货币交易,还能广泛应用于智能合约、数字身份、供应链管理等领域。
然而,许多人对区块链的了解往往停留在概念的层面,实际上,要深入理解区块链,我们必须从它的基础层级开始探索。区块链的基础层级主要包括以下几个方面:
区块链的最基本单位就是“区块”。一个区块通常包含三部分内容:区块头、区块体以及交易信息。区块头中包含了区块的元数据,比如时间戳、前一个区块的哈希、随机数(Nonce)等;区块体则包含了一系列的交易记录。这些信息通过加密技术确保数据的安全及完整性。
每当一个新的交易发生时,它会被打包到一个新的区块中。当这个区块被填满后,矿工会通过复杂的计算过程来验证这个区块的合法性。一旦验证通过,新的区块会被添加到区块链的尾部,形成一个不可篡改的链条。
在区块链的网络中,节点是参与数据维护的每一个设备或计算机。每个节点都有一份完整的区块链副本,这种去中心化的设计使得区块链更具韧性,可以有效防止单点故障。当某个节点出现问题时,其他节点仍然能够继续保持网络的正常运作。
节点的角色在不同的区块链中可能有所不同。例如,在比特币网络中,节点可以分为全节点和轻节点,全节点能够对网络中的所有交易进行验证,而轻节点则只需要保持部分交易信息。此外,某些区块链还采用了专门的节点类型,如矿工节点和验证节点,进一步提升了网络的安全性及效率。
区块链的运行依赖于一套特定的网络协议,协议的设计直接影响着区块链的性能和安全性。常见的网络协议包括工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。这些协议各自有着不同的优缺点,适用于不同的应用场景。
例如,工作量证明机制要求参与者通过计算复杂的数学问题来获得记账权,这不仅保证了网络的安全性,也实现了去中心化。然而,这种机制也造成了高能耗和计算资源浪费的问题;而权益证明机制则通过持币数量和时间来决定参与者的记账权,使得资源的利用更为高效。
共识机制是区块链网络中确保所有节点就数据状态达成一致的重要机制。通过共识机制,区块链能够在多个参与者之间对交易的有效性达成一致,从而避免了双重支付等安全隐患。不同的区块链系统采用了不同的共识机制,而这些机制通常会影响到网络的安全性、扩展性和效率。
除了工作量证明和权益证明之外,还有一些其他的共识机制,如拜占庭容错机制(PBFT)和零知识证明等,它们各自有着不同的应用场景,比如金融科技、供应链管理等新兴领域。
智能合约是区块链的一大创新,它利用区块链的透明性和不可篡改性来实现自动化的合约执行。智能合约是一种程序代码,当预设的条件被满足时,合约的内容会自动执行,无需中介的干预。这不仅极大地提高了交易的效率,也减少了信任成本。
智能合约广泛应用于金融领域、房地产交易、物联网设备管理等。在实际应用中,智能合约可以用于资金的自动流转、资产的所有权转移等,极大地提高了交易的安全性和可靠性。
随着技术的发展,区块链在多个领域的应用潜力日益凸显。以下是几个主要的应用场景:
1.金融领域:区块链能够实现点对点的交易,减少中介费用,提升交易效率,改善跨境支付体验。
2.供应链管理:通过区块链,所有的交易记录都可以安全且透明地进行管理,减少信息不对称,提升供应链的透明度和效率。
3.物联网:区块链为物联网设备提供了一个安全的管理机制,设备可以在一个去中心化的平台上进行自主交互和数据交换。
4.数字身份:利用区块链技术,用户的身份信息可以被安全存储,使得身份验证过程变得更为迅速和安全。
去中心化是区块链技术最核心的特征之一,它的优点主要体现在以下几个方面:
首先,去中心化提升了网络的安全性。在传统的中心化系统中,单一的故障点可能会导致整个系统的崩溃。而在区块链中,因为数据分散存储在多个节点,即使部分节点失效,系统依然能够正常运行。
其次,去中心化能够提高交易的效率和透明度。每个节点都能够查看所有的交易信息,有效地降低了信息不对称所带来的商业风险。
然而,去中心化也会面临一些挑战,如隐私问题、效率问题等。例如,尽管去中心化降低了单点故障的风险,却可能增加了恶意攻击的复杂性,因为攻击者需要同时控制多个节点才能对系统进行操控。此外,去中心化的网络在处理速度上往往无法与中心化的系统相比较,特别是在用户数量大幅增加时,交易处理的延迟可能会显著上升。
智能合约是通过特定的编程语言编写的程序,它在区块链上运行,并能够自动执行合约条款。当事人可以在数字环境中通过智能合约设定条件,一旦这些条件被满足,智能合约就会自动执行。这种机制大幅提升了交易的效率,无需中介介入。
智能合约的运行依赖于区块链的不可篡改性和透明性,它确保了合约的内容不会被篡改,同时也使得合约的执行过程对所有参与者开放,增加了信任度。这种特性使得智能合约在金融、房地产、保险等多个领域都展现出了巨大的应用潜力。
然而,智能合约也并非没有缺陷。它们的设计和实现必须严谨,任何漏洞都可能导致资金的损失。此外,智能合约的法律地位在不同国家和地区也仍然存在不确定性,激烈的市场变化可能会对智能合约的效果产生影响。
区块链技术通过多种机制来保障数据的安全性。其中最核心的机制是加密技术,所有的交易信息在被记录到区块链之前都会经过加密处理,确保数据在存储和传输过程中不被篡改。每个区块都包含前一个区块的哈希值作为链接,形成不可改变的链条.
一旦数据被写入区块链,就无法被随意修改或者删除,从而有效保护数据的完整性。此外,区块链的去中心化特性也使得恶意攻击者需要控制网络中大量的节点才能对系统造成威胁,这大大提高了系统的抗攻击能力。
然而,区块链并不能全面保障数据的安全性。在用户身份验证、私钥管理等环节上,用户依然需要保持警惕,以避免因自身操作失误导致的损失。
在全球范围内,区块链的应用正呈现出蓬勃发展的趋势。除了最初的加密货币领域,更多的传统行业也开始积极探索区块链的应用。尤其是在金融领域,诸如国际支付、资产管理、信用评级等,多项业务已经开始尝试通过区块链实现效率提升和成本减少。
除了金融领域,供应链管理也是区块链技术的重要应用场景。多家大型企业通过区块链技术实现了对产品流向的透明追踪,客户可以通过扫描二维码等方式实时查看商品的来源和流向。这不仅增加了消费者的信任,也为品牌价值的提升打下了基础。
在物流、医疗、政府公共服务等领域,也有越来越多的项目开始采用区块链技术。尽管目前区块链仍处于发展的初期阶段,但我们可以预见,在未来,它将成为信息管理和交易处理的基础设施。
尽管区块链技术在多个领域展现了巨大的潜力和优势,但其发展面临的各种挑战也不容忽视。首先,技术的复杂性使得普及和应用变得困难,许多企业缺乏这方面的人才,导致项目的推进乏力。
其次,不同区块链平台之间的互操作性问题,往往造成数据孤岛,导致信息不能共享。此外,区块链交易的处理速度较传统中心化系统来说依然较慢,限制了其在高频交易等场景的应用。
此外,法律和监管问题也是区块链技术发展中的一个重要挑战。由于区块链的去中心化特性,相关法律法规的建立与实施面临许多挑战,包括数据隐私保护、合规性、安全性等方面,亟待相关法律的快速完善。
总结起来,区块链作为一项具有革命性的技术,正在不断发展并逐步渗透到各个行业。理解区块链的基础层级和结构对于我们把握这一前沿技术的应用前景至关重要。随着技术的不断成熟和应用落地,区块链的未来无疑将更加广阔。